Typical Indications That Suggest the Need for Repiping



House owners ought to be vigilant for sure indications that suggest the demand for repiping, as neglecting these issues can result in more severe pipes troubles. One typical indication is the visibility of constant leakages, which can recommend aging or deteriorating pipelines. In addition, an obvious decrease in water stress may show clogs or corrosion within the pipes system. House owners might likewise see stained or rustic water, indicating pipe degradation. Unexplained water bills that are markedly higher than normal can likewise mean leaks hidden within the walls. Moreover, the advancement of mold and mildew or mildew in areas near pipes components can recommend wetness problems coming from damaged pipes. Ultimately, if the home has old galvanized piping, it may be time to think concerning repiping, as this product is prone to rust and rust. Identifying these indicators early can aid keep a healthy pipes system.

Various Sorts Of Piping Materials



Piping materials are an essential part in plumbing systems, influencing durability, performance, and overall performance. Numerous choices are available, each with one-of-a-kind homes and applications. Copper piping is known for its long life and resistance to rust, making it a prominent choice for both cold and warm water lines. PVC (polyvinyl chloride) is lightweight, cost-effective, and immune to chemical damage, largely utilized for drain and air vent systems. PEX (cross-linked polyethylene) has gained appeal due to its adaptability and simplicity of installment, permitting fewer joints and prospective leak factors. Galvanized steel, though when typical, is less positive today as a result of its sensitivity to corrosion and minimized water flow gradually. Each material offers distinctive benefits and drawbacks, making it essential for home owners to seek advice from with pipes professionals to determine the most ideal alternative for their particular requirements and problems. Selecting the ideal piping material can significantly influence the performance and safety and security of a pipes system.

Installment Process Summary



Repiping a home can be a substantial task, yet comprehending the installation procedure assists property owners prepare for what lies ahead. The procedure generally begins with a comprehensive inspection of the existing pipes system to identify problem locations. Next off, a detailed plan is developed, laying out the needed materials and timelines. On the installation day, professionals will certainly frequently begin by closing off the water system and draining pipes the existing pipelines. They then eliminate the old piping, which may include opening up wall surfaces or ceilings for access. Brand-new pipelines are set up, ensuring they fulfill current pipes codes. Lastly, the system is checked for leaks, and any kind of openings are fixed. Property owners can expect a clean and efficient process, minimizing disruption to their day-to-day lives.

What Is the Typical Cost of Repiping a Home?



The typical cost of repiping a home commonly ranges from $4,000 to $15,000, depending on aspects such as the size of your house, materials made use of, and labor costs linked with the plumbing job. Houston Repiping.
